Rosé Majeur is the perfect embodiment of the originality and finesse of the House’s wines. Made predominantly from Chardonnay it is crafted with the addition of a small proportion of Pinot Noir from the best crus of the Montagne de Reims. A low dosage enables it to express the House style, both feminine and generous, with great elegance. The very high proportion of Chardonnay and the ageing process result in a Champagne with remarkable finesse.

Brut Rosé Majeur shines with freshness on the palate, offering immediate pleasure and well-balanced flavors. The cuvée  is 51% Chardonnay, 39% Pinot Noir, 10% Pinot Meunier. Six percent of red wine from Aÿ was added to the blend of 24 crus. Three years of aging on the lees, more than twice that is required by the appellation. Only 6g/l dosage.

Vineyard

Ayala currently owns 35 acres in Champagne. Thanks to its privileged location in the heart of the Grand Crus of Montagne de Reims and their link to Bollinger, they also have unique access to top quality grapes.

Winemaking

Brut Rosé Majeur is a blend of Chardonnay (51%), Pinot Noir (40%) and Pinot Meunier (9%). The very high proportion of Chardonnay and the aging process result in a Champagne with remarkable finesse and elegance. Everything from grape reception to vinification, aging, riddling and disgorgement is done at the Ayala cellars. Brut Rosé Majeur is fermented in stainless steel, with a focus on freshness and precision. It spends 2.5 years on the lees and rests in the cellar for at least 3 months after disgorgement.

Farming

Ayala encourages their growers to use organic fertilizers and avoid insecticides, herbicides and pesticides.
